A voidable contract is a legal agreement that is considered to be valid and enforceable at the time it is entered into, but which can be voided or canceled at a later time if certain conditions are met. The effect of a voidable contract can be significant, as it can leave both parties uncertain about their legal obligations and can lead to costly disputes and legal battles.

One of the primary effects of a voidable contract is that it can create ambiguity and uncertainty regarding the legal rights and obligations of the parties involved. If a contract is later found to be voidable, both parties may be left unsure about whether they are bound by the terms of the agreement or if the contract can be canceled or modified in some way.

In some cases, a voidable contract may be canceled outright, which can have significant financial implications. For example, if a party has entered into a contract to purchase a piece of property, but the contract is later found to be voidable, they may be forced to cancel the purchase and potentially lose any money that they have already invested in the deal.

Another significant effect of a voidable contract is the potential for legal disputes and litigation. If one party seeks to void the contract and the other party disagrees, they may need to engage in a lengthy and costly legal battle to resolve the issue. Even if the contract is ultimately found to be voidable, it can still take significant time and money to resolve the matter.
